The Small Business Development Center (SBDC) at Delta State University in Cleveland, Mississippi, is a non-profit, professional, small business assistance service funded by Delta State University, the U. S. Small Business Administration, and the Mississippi Small Business Development Centers. The program is designed to provide assistance to individuals interested in starting a small business and with business planning, financial analysis, management, and marketing for existing business. Services are provided at little or no cost. Our service area covers thirteen counties in the Delta region of Mississippi. These counties include Bolivar, Carroll, Coahoma, Grenada, Humphries, Issaquena, Leflore, Quitman, Sharkey, Sunflower, Tallahatchie, Tunica, and Washington. The mission of the Delta State University Small Business Development Center is to help small businesses in the Mississippi Delta grow and prosper.
